Burnsville launches neighborhood organization pilot; up to $100,000 allocated for grants
Summary
Council heard a mid‑pilot update on Burnsville’s neighborhood organization and grants program. Staff said eight groups have contacted the city, two neighborhoods are essentially established, and the city expects to collect grant applications this fall with awards later in the year.
City staff told Burnsville City Council the neighborhood organization and grants pilot is halfway through its first year and beginning to show community interest, with eight neighborhood groups engaging staff and two — North River Hills and Parkwood South (previously Willow Ridge) — effectively organized.
